在网页设计和开发的领域里,JSON(JavaScript Object Notation)是一种轻量级的数据交换格式,它基于JavaScript的一个子集,但是独立于语言,易于人阅读和编写,同时也易于机器解析和生成,Dreamweaver,作为一款强大的网页设计和开发工具,可以帮助我们轻松地编写和处理JSON数据,就让我们一起来如何在Dreamweaver中编写JSON。
让我们了解一下JSON的基本概念,JSON是一种格式,用于存储和传输数据,它以文本为基础,格式类似于JavaScript对象字面量,但JSON仅支持数据结构,如数字、字符串、数组和对象等,JSON的结构非常简洁,易于理解和使用,这使得它在数据交换和网络通信中非常受欢迎。
在Dreamweaver中编写JSON,我们可以遵循以下步骤:
1、创建一个新的文件:在Dreamweaver中,我们首先需要创建一个新的文件,选择“文件”菜单,然后点击“新建”,接着选择“HTML”作为文件类型,这样,我们就创建了一个空白的HTML文件,接下来我们可以在这个文件中编写我们的JSON数据。
2、编写JSON数据:在HTML文件的<body>标签内,我们可以开始编写JSON数据,JSON数据通常以大括号{}开始和结束,表示一个对象,在这个对象内部,我们可以定义一系列的键值对,键和值之间用冒号:分隔,而键值对之间则用逗号,分隔。
{
"name": "John Doe",
"age": 30,
"isMarried": false,
"children": [
{
"name": "Jane Doe",
"age": 10
},
{
"name": "Doe Junior",
"age": 5
}
]
}在这个例子中,我们定义了一个包含个人信息的对象,包括姓名、年龄、婚姻状况以及一个包含孩子信息的数组。
3、使用JavaScript处理JSON:在Dreamweaver中,我们可以通过JavaScript来处理JSON数据,我们需要将JSON字符串转换为JavaScript对象,这可以通过JSON.parse()方法实现,我们可以使用JavaScript的属性和方法来访问和操作这些数据。
var userData = JSON.parse('{"name": "John Doe", "age": 30}');
console.log(userData.name); // 输出: John Doe 在这个例子中,我们首先使用JSON.parse()将JSON字符串转换为JavaScript对象,然后通过属性访问来获取用户的姓名。
4、动态生成JSON:在实际的开发中,我们可能需要根据用户输入或其他动态数据来生成JSON,在Dreamweaver中,我们可以通过JavaScript对象字面量来构建JSON数据。
var user = {
name: "Jane Doe",
age: 25
};
var userJson = JSON.stringify(user);
console.log(userJson); // 输出: {"name": "Jane Doe", "age": 25} 在这个例子中,我们首先创建了一个JavaScript对象user,然后使用JSON.stringify()方法将这个对象转换为JSON字符串。
5、验证JSON格式:在编写JSON数据时,我们可能会遇到格式错误,为了确保我们的JSON数据是有效的,我们可以使用在线的JSON验证工具,或者在Dreamweaver中使用JavaScript来检查。
try {
var data = JSON.parse('{"name": "John Doe"}');
console.log(data.name); // 输出: John Doe
} catch (e) {
console.error("Invalid JSON: ", e);
} 在这个例子中,我们使用try...catch语句来捕获任何在解析JSON时发生的错误,并输出错误信息。
通过以上步骤,我们可以在Dreamweaver中有效地编写和处理JSON数据,JSON的简洁性和灵活性使其成为现代网络应用中不可或缺的一部分,在Dreamweaver中编写JSON的技能,将有助于我们更高效地开发动态和交互式的网页应用。



还没有评论,来说两句吧...